4,577 Steps to Miles, By Height
The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 4,577 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.
| Height | Distance |
|---|---|
| Short (~5'2") | 1.85 mi |
| Average (~5'7") | 2.00 mi |
| Tall (~6'2") | 2.21 mi |

Where 4,577 Steps Ranks
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 4,577 steps falls.
| Activity Level | Daily Steps |
|---|---|
| Sedentary | Under 5,000 |
| Low Active | 5,000–7,499 |
| Somewhat Active | 7,500–9,999 |
| Active | 10,000–12,499 |
| Highly Active | 12,500+ |
Did You Know?
At its peak, the Roman road network stretched over 250,000 miles, with stone milestones planted every thousand paces so army commanders could calculate march times. It's one of the earliest large-scale uses of a standardized steps-to-distance conversion.
Canadian Jean Béliveau holds the record for the longest continuous walk ever documented: roughly 46,600 miles across 64 countries over 11 years, starting in 2000. That's close to circling the Earth's equator twice.
